Loudon begins by re-examining blackbody radiation. He details the failure of classical mechanics (the ultraviolet catastrophe) and introduces the necessity of energy quantization. The text meticulously derives the statistical distributions of photons, explaining the differences between thermal light, coherent light (lasers), and squeezed states. 2. The Quantum Theory of Light by Rodney Loudon is widely considered the "gold standard" for anyone transitioning from classical optics to the quantum regime. Since its first publication in 1973, it has served as the definitive bridge for students and researchers aiming to understand how light behaves at its most fundamental level.

The core of the work lies in the , where Loudon treats the electromagnetic field as a collection of quantum-mechanical harmonic oscillators. This framework allows for the exploration of phenomena that classical wave theory cannot explain:
